**TICKET-4471: logtail CLI credentials expired**

The shared credential for the Pinefort logtail CLI expired Tuesday. Anyone running `logtail follow` against the Harbinger aggregator gets 401s. On-call has been shelling into boxes directly, which is slow and bad. A replacement key was minted this morning with the same read-only scope. Rotation cadence moves to 90 days going forward. For the sync: the new key is below.

gateway credential: kto15_BFZGGy3oznOSd45

## Encoding Detection — Support Runbook Fragment

When a customer reports garbled text after uploading a file to Textporter, the detector has likely misclassified the encoding. Check the detection log for the upload, confirm the guessed charset, and re-queue the file with a forced encoding if needed. Log entries live in the ingest database, which you can reach with the connection string below.

replica DSN, kajep-yahag: mssql://praok_svc:iF@db-8d68.plorvaio.local:5432/eliion

Facilities Ticket — Cleaning Crew Access, Brindle Annex

For new starters handling evening lock-up: the Sorano Cleaning crew arrives nightly at 21:30 via the annex side door. Check their rota sheet, note arrival in the log, and ensure the storeroom is relocked afterward. To let them through the side door, enter the access code below.

badge for yaweg-hafog: bdg-GX-6